Singh was a UNSC Naval crewman who was assigned to the Pillar of Autumn. On September 19, 2552, he was listed as a crewman on Charlie Shift on Pillar of Autumn's duty roster.[1] He escaped in the escape pod Kilo Tango Victor 17 with some other crewmen, Marines and his commanding officer, Captain Keyes.[2] He was the first to think that Ensign Ellen Dowski was a traitor and suggested that she be shot. Keyes was more lenient and decided to tie her up and leave her.[3] Later, the Covenant found Dowski, who told where to find the survivors, resulting in the deaths of Singh and all, with the exception of Keyes, of the crewmen.[3]
